Summary:
Changing menu structure not possible
Detailed Description:
If a user is only allowed to change one page and the subpages it's not possible
to change the structure of the subpages. That's only possible if he has the
right "modify any content" or "modify all content". But then he can change all
pages and not only his page.

For example: 
Menu 1 
----------Menu 1.1
-------------Menu 1.1.1
----------Menu 1.2
Menu 2

User has only permission to modify menu 1 and subpages. Iit's not possible to
move menu 1.2 before menu 1.1. The arrows for moving the pages up and down are
not shown.

Hello,

This is a feature of this permission setting.
The user can change the content of the pages not the structure itself.
So it is not a bug.
